Udhayanidhi Stalin announces that “Maamannan” will be the last film.

Maamannan, the highly awaited project with a star-studded ensemble of Keerthy Suresh, Fahadh Faasil, and Vadivelu, will be Udhayanidhi Stalin‘s last film. He is also financing the picture through his production company, Red Giant Movies. In a recent interview, he announced that Maamannan will be his final film as an actor. According to reports, balancing movies and politics has been challenging for him.

Udhyanidhi Stalin is a politician who is very active, as his father is the Chief Minister of Tamil Nadu. However, in order to devote his whole attention to politics, he chose to discontinue his film career. The trailer for filmmaker Arunraja Kamaraj’s much-anticipated film, Nenjuku Needhi, has been published, and it includes certain passages that allude to Udhayanidhi’s political stance.
